The Verizon version will not be a world phone: “We are working hard to provide Nexus One phones optimized for the Verizon network – please stay tuned. The Nexus One for Verizon will not be a GSM device, so it will not be compatible with T-Mobile, AT&T, or other GSM networks.”

The Nexus One cell phone has a 3.7 inch AMOLED display with 480 x 800 pixels, 5MP autofocus camera with flash, 1GHz Snapdragon processor, trackball , GPS, Wi-Fi,  light and proximity sensors, compass, accelerometer, enhanced news and weather widgets, stereo Bluetooth, 3.5mm headset jack, runs Android 2.1, 512MB Flash, 512MB RAM, 4GB MicroSD card included card supports to 32G.
